Claudia Auladell Quintana

St Feliu de Guíxols, en la Costa Brava, Girona, Spain

“I believe in the power of small individual actions to change the world “

Marine biologist specialized in marine mammals.

I am a Marine biologist with a degree in Environmental Biology from the Universidad Autonoma de Barcelona , and a speciality in Marine Biology from the Universidad de la Laguna, Tenerife. I also have a master’s degree in Marine Mammal Science from the University of St Andrews, Scotland.

I have worked in many different countries, universities and companies investigating marine mammals: porpoises in Ireland, bottlenose dolphins in the Azores, humpback whales in Mexico, cetacean density in Macaronesia in Madeira, and bottlenose dolphins and their interactions with fishing vessels in Cadaques, Spain.

I am a nature lover, and whenever I can I collaborate to organize beach and forest clean-ups in my local area. I belong to a local naturalist association, and I am passionate about educating and raising awareness among people around me, particularly young people because I believe they will be the engine of the change that is coming.
